In figure (1) given below, ABCD is a parallelogram with perimeter 40. Find the values of x and y.

Answer
In parallelogram opposite sides are equal.
∴ BC = AD = 2x and
AB = CD
⇒ 3x = 2y + 2
⇒ 2y = 3x - 2
⇒ y = ……..(i)
Given, perimeter = 40.
⇒ AB + BC + CD + AD = 40
⇒ 3x + 2x + 2y + 2 + 2x = 40
⇒ 3x + 2x + + 2 + 2x = 40
⇒ 3x + 2x + 3x - 2 + 2 + 2x = 40
⇒ 10x = 40
⇒ x = 4.
⇒ y = .
Hence, x = 4 and y = 5.
